North Macedonia passport holders require a visa to enter South Africa.

Apply at the South African Embassy in Vienna. Required documents include a completed application, passport photos, bank statements, proof of accommodation, return flights, and a yellow fever vaccination certificate if arriving from a yellow fever zone. Processing typically takes 7 to 15 business days.

North Macedonia to South Africa: What You Need to Know

South Africa does not grant visa-free entry to North Macedonian passport holders. Citizens must apply for a temporary residence visa (visitor's visa) before travel. South Africa is a popular destination for wildlife safaris, coastal tourism, and wine country. The nearest South African Embassy covering North Macedonia is in Vienna. Processing times can vary.

Practical Tips

Book accommodation and flights before submitting your visa application. South African airports accept arrivals without a yellow fever certificate if not transiting through endemic zones. Ensure your passport has at least 30 days validity beyond your intended stay.

Do I need a yellow fever certificate to enter South Africa?

A yellow fever certificate is required only if you are arriving from a country with a risk of yellow fever transmission. If traveling from North Macedonia without transiting through an endemic zone, it is not required.

How long can North Macedonian passport holders stay in South Africa on a visitor visa?

Typically up to 90 days, though the authorized period is determined by the visa granted and confirmed by the immigration officer on arrival.
